Each season many bus loads of people come to our farm to pick sweet cherries. Half of the trips are exclusively for picking cherries. The other half takes advantage of our location and visit the Niagara area for the balance of the day.

Most bus groups choose to spend one to one and a half hours on the property. There are plenty of parking spaces for buses and highway coaches. Upon entry, one of our staff members will greet your tour and explain the farm policies and procedures. Please read 'Policies' and 'Tips'. Guests are encouraged to drink water or other liquids before entering the orchard.

Each person entering the orchard will have a choice of five different purchasing options. Please refer to our 2008 price list for details. It is important to note that each guest over age 12 must pre-purchase an E.D. Smith cherry pail prior to entering the orchard. Admission to our farm is free.

Our farm gates are open from 8:00 am to 7:00 pm on weekends and holidays; and from 10:00 am to 7:00 pm on weekdays.

As our way of saying thank you, the bus tour leader of each group of 30 or more people who purchase a pail of cherries will receive a complimentary standard pail to pick cherries and the bus driver will receive a complimentary mini pail. 

New for the 2008 cherry picking season. We are introducing an exclusive cherry picking area on our North Farm. This area is reserved strictly for bus tour groups. There is ample parking for buses a short distance from the orchard and the Welcome Centre offers modern washroom facilities. Cherry picking locations may vary depending on supply.
